Hellmann's Real Mayonnaise: The Classic Breakdown
The iconic Hellmann's Real Mayonnaise, known as Best Foods in some regions, is a staple condiment in many households. Its signature creamy texture and rich flavor are a result of its simple core ingredients: oil, cage-free eggs, and vinegar. For those monitoring their caloric intake, understanding the specific nutritional details is essential.
Per-Serving Calorie Count
A standard 1-tablespoon serving (approximately 13g) of Hellmann's Real Mayonnaise contains approximately 90 calories. It's important to note that the calorie content can vary slightly depending on the region due to different ingredient formulations. For example, some sources may list 100 calories per tablespoon, reflecting a slightly different ingredient mix or serving size.
Macronutrient Profile
The vast majority of the calories in Real Mayonnaise come from fat. In a typical tablespoon serving, you can expect around 10 grams of total fat, which contributes significantly to the overall calorie count. The fat is a mix of monounsaturated and polyunsaturated fats, including a good source of Omega-3 ALA. This condiment contains negligible amounts of carbohydrates and protein.
Calorie-Conscious Choices: Hellmann's Lighter Options
For those looking to reduce their calorie and fat intake without sacrificing flavor, Hellmann's offers several alternatives. These products are formulated to be lighter while maintaining a satisfying taste.
Hellmann's Light Mayonnaise
Hellmann's Light Mayonnaise is a popular alternative, boasting significantly fewer calories and fat than the real version.
- Calorie Content: One tablespoon contains just 35-40 calories, a substantial reduction from the 90 calories in the real version.
- Ingredient Changes: This is achieved by reducing the oil content and replacing it with water and other stabilizers like modified food starch.
Hellmann's Vegan Mayonnaise
This plant-based option replaces the eggs with ingredients like modified potato starch to create a creamy texture suitable for vegan diets.
- Calorie Content: Vegan mayonnaise typically falls in between the real and light versions, with roughly 70-98 calories per tablespoon, depending on the market and specific formulation.
- Healthier Fats: It often features a different oil blend, like rapeseed or sunflower oil, and remains a source of Omega-3s.
Comparative Calorie and Nutrition Table
To make an informed decision, here is a side-by-side comparison of the calorie and fat content per tablespoon for three main Hellmann's varieties.
| Product | Calories (per 1 tbsp) | Total Fat (g) | Saturated Fat (g)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Real Mayonnaise | 90-100 | 10 | 1.5-2 |
| Light Mayonnaise | 35-40 | 3.5 | 0.5 |
| Vegan Mayonnaise | 70-98 | 8-11 | 0-0.8 |
The Role of Calories in a Balanced Diet
While Hellmann's Real Mayonnaise is high in calories, it's not inherently "bad" for you. As long as it is consumed in moderation as part of a balanced diet, it can be a source of healthful fats. The key is mindful consumption, especially if you are managing your weight. Lighter options, such as Hellmann's Light Mayonnaise, offer a way to reduce calorie intake without eliminating the condiment entirely. It is always best to read the nutritional information on the packaging of the specific product you are purchasing, as formulations can differ by country and time.
Smart Ways to Enjoy Mayonnaise in Moderation
Balancing your diet doesn't mean cutting out all your favorite foods. Instead, it's about making smarter choices and controlling portion sizes. Here are a few strategies for enjoying Hellmann's mayonnaise without overdoing the calories:
- Use the Light or Vegan versions in place of Real Mayonnaise for a lower-calorie alternative.
- Measure your serving size carefully instead of free-hand dolloping from the jar.
- Mix mayonnaise with other ingredients to create a healthier spread, such as combining it with Greek yogurt, mustard, or herbs.
- Use mayonnaise sparingly as a binding agent or flavor booster in recipes rather than a primary ingredient. It works great for things like chicken salad or tuna salad.
- Consider using it in recipes that feature other healthy ingredients, like salads with lots of vegetables or whole-grain sandwiches.
